Community Connectors & Mental Health Wellbeing Hub - Spalding & South Lincolnshire Rural
Commission a Community Connectors and Mental Health Wellbeing Hub service in Spalding and South Lincolnshire Rural, valued at £386,303 over 2 years and 7 months.
